When it comes to liquefied petroleum gas (LPG) systems, ensuring safety is paramount, and the LPG valve plays a crucial role in this regard. An LPG valve is designed to regulate the flow of gas from the storage container to your appliances, making it a key component in any LPG setup. Selecting a reliable LPG valve not only enhances safety but also contributes to the overall efficiency of your gas usage.

One of the primary functions of an LPG valve is its ability to control gas flow. It allows users to easily switch the gas supply on and off, providing a quick means to manage the flow of gas for cooking, heating, or other applications. Additionally, many modern LPG valves are equipped with safety features such as auto shut-off mechanisms, which automatically close the valve if a leak is detected or if the temperature exceeds a certain threshold. This feature is essential for preventing dangerous gas leaks, thus protecting both life and property.

However, potential buyers should be aware of both the advantages and disadvantages associated with LPG valves. On the positive side, LPG valves are generally made from durable materials, ensuring a long lifespan when properly maintained. They are also relatively easy to install and operate, which is a significant benefit for DIY enthusiasts. Conversely, some users have reported that lower-quality valves may develop leaks over time, underscoring the importance of selecting a reputable brand. Additionally, maintenance is necessary to ensure the valve functions properly, which can sometimes be overlooked by users.

Regarding pricing, the market offers a wide range of LPG valves to choose from. Generally, the price of an LPG valve can range from $15 to $60, depending on the brand, quality, and additional safety features. While it might be tempting to go for the cheapest option, investing in a more reliable valve often results in long-term savings. A higher-quality LPG valve may have a higher initial cost but will typically pay off through enhanced safety and reduced risks of gas-related issues. Furthermore, many reputable brands offer warranties, which can provide added assurance to consumers about their investment.
